City Crews Install 55-Foot Christmas Tree for Honolulu City Lights
City crews in Honolulu are currently installing a grand 55-foot Cook pine tree at Honolulu Hale, marking the festive beginning of the holiday season. This tree will serve as the centerpiece for the 41st Honolulu City Lights, set to open on November 29, 2025. The installation process began on November 5, 2025, as workers carefully maneuvered the tree into place, ensuring it stands tall in front of the municipal building.
